This certification cycle will enable you to master the procedure for awarding public contracts, from the formulation of requirements through to contract monitoring. You will learn about the legal and regulatory framework, as well as the main provisions of the French Public Procurement Code. You will learn how to design and draw up a consultation file, then select the bids. Finally, you will learn how to secure the administrative, technical and financial aspects of your contracts.
